#!/usr/bin/env perl # Copyright (C) 2008, The Perl Foundation. =head1 DESCRIPTION This tool runs all spectests, except those that C runs (that means all tests of which we don't know yet if they will pass or not). For each file that passes at least one test (criterion might change in future) it prints out a short summary about the status of this file. This is primarily used to identify tests that could be added to F, and those that are worth a closer look. But please don't add them blindly just because they all pass - chances are that there's a good reason for them not already being included.
